Rare Hlitner Posted September 29, 2018 #6 Share Posted September 29, 2018 One big pro on the Golden is that it has an all weather pool (with retractable roof). This was eliminated from all the newer Grand Class ships and also does not exist on the Royal Class. Hank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Rare cr8tiv1 Posted October 2, 2018 #14 Share Posted October 2, 2018 We are doing SB Alaska next August on Golden. Booked this ship mainly because of its size and having the indoor pool option. Does the Golden have a thermal suite spa? No Thermal Suite Spa. Just the ordinary "free" sets up (sauna, serenity pool, etc). No heated loungers.
